SUMMARY:Contemporary dance workshop | Dada Theatre
DESCRIPTION:Activity: contemporary dance workshop.\nPublic: all audiences.\nFree activity without the need for advance reservation.\nMore information: info@espailobrador.com\n \nSynopsis\n‘Mindfulness in motion’ is a contemporary dance workshop with live music by Maria Papadopoulos. This workshop will allow us, through movement, to connect with the present moment. Thus, the workshop will develop from small choreographic and musical exercises and synchronized movement phrases. Through work on the floor, relaxation techniques, individual exercises and in duos, and improvisations, a balance will be created between the body and the mind, and between our natural movement and the one that will be tried to learn.\n \nBiography\nDada Theatre is a contemporary dance group founded in Gdańsk in 1993 by the choreographer and director Leszek Bzdyl and the dancer and choreographer Katarzyna Chmielewska, who is a graduate of the Gdańsk ballet school and the contemporary dance school in Brussels.\nThe Dada von Bzdülöw Theatre operates within a space where acting and dance expression meet. The theatre contrasts high culture with kitsch and makes use of trivial everyday elements and the poetics of pure nonsense. The dance group uses the plastic qualities of stages to construct the atmospheres of the group’s plays, amongst others. In a single play by the Dada von Bzdülöw Theatre pastiche quotation marks and serious lyrical tones might appear. According to the members of the group the most interesting things in art are created within areas where various forms and styles meet. That is why the theatre’s actors willingly make use of various conventions in their realizations – they refer to circus theatre, fairground theatre and pantomime. Their choreographies are filled with inspirations from literary traditions.\n \nOrganized by: ROPA / Roberto Olivan Performing Arts and L’OBRADOR Espai de Creació.\nWith the support of: Departament de Cultura de la Generalitat de Catalunya and Diputació de Tarragona.\n
